The 2008 Fratelli Serio and Battista Borgogno Nebbiolo d'Alba is a really tasty treat. 100% Nebbiolo, mainly from Diano D'Alba, it has a pretty ruby color and a nice smoky aroma. You'll get a mouthful of spice and raspberries upon tasting it. Definitely fruitier than most of the classic Piedmont varietals, this wine still obviously has years to mature and turn into something really special. — 10 years ago

The origins of the Damilano family dates back to over a century ago, when Guiseppe Borgogno, the great-grandfather of the current owners, started to grow and make wine from his own grapes. Medium Ruby with aromas of fresh berry fruits and generous spice. On the palate this medium body wine shows flavors of juicy cherry and blackberry with notes of citrus and vanilla spice. Light tannin structure, lively acidity, medium ending with fruit finish. Nice value. Drink now, consistent, no aging benefit. — a year ago
